Encourage

#Beingaleader means it’s your job to encourage others. To encourage is to give someone else the courage to keep going. To finish a task or to keep plugging along. To give them hope and strength.

But how do you encourage someone? Here are three ways: tell someone that they can do it; that they have what it takes. Remind them of past victories/successes that apply to the present situation. And say something about their character that perhaps they have forgotten or can’t see in the moment. These three ways can be applied to friends, family and colleagues.

Tell them they can do it. I know that sounds obvious. But it still can be very powerful to actually verbalize to someone that you believe in them. That they have what it takes. So many people lack confidence. Even given a history of successes. Whether it’s insecurity or fear of failure, many people need this type of out loud statement on a regular basis.

Remind them of past successes. Confidence can come when they are reminded of past successes. Whether it’s a similar task or totally different challenge, just reminding them that they’ve achieved success before can provide the inspiration to believe in themselves for the current situation.

Say something about their character. Sometimes it’s not enough to simply outline past successes. Sometimes it’s deeper than that and it’s important to tell them that you believe in them. That they have what it takes.
